I've only made a couple cdlc's, But when I use the toolkit I always Generate PC Only. Because I don't own a mac, ps3,  or xbox 360. But:Should I generate them anyway? Even If I cannot support them?

I always do pc and 360 that way if someone has mac or ps3 they can easily just open the toolkit and convert it with just a click.

I only do PC.  I tried generating a Mac psarc once and since I don't have a Mac I couldn't verify that it worked.  It didn't work 3 times and it took a week or 2 between each posting for someone to tell me that.  Never again.

The reason I do pc and 360 is I obviously can test the pc version and enough ppl try the 360 version and like it that im confident it works without testing it.  Mac and ps3 are very rarely requested and so I never do those unless someone asks plus like cstewart says it can take along time for someone to actually say something if somethings not working for those.  In all my customs only 2 people asked for a mac version and nobody has ever asked for a ps3 version.
